| Produto: | |
|---|---|
| Linha de Produto: | |
| Segmento: | |
| Módulo: | Plano de Saúde - SIGAPLS |
| Função: | XMLImport |
| País: | Brasil |
| Ticket: | 19803704 |
| Requisito/Story/Issue (informe o requisito relacionado) : | DSAUPC-20311 |
Criação de um ponto de entrada na rotina PLROBOTXML, para que seja possível realizar filtros e validações, como por exemplo um RDA especifico.
Nome do ponto de entrada: PLROBPRC
Parâmetros:
Descrição: O ponto de entrada permite aplicar filtros e validações para execução do processamento xml.
Programa Fonte: PLROBOTXML
Função: XMLIMPORT
Retorno: Nome: cQuery+cWhere | Tipo: string | Descrição: Retorna consulta a ser aplicada no processo de execução do robo xml | Obrigatório: Sim
Retorno: O retorno do Ponto de Entrada deve ser uma string contendo os filtros da cláusula 'where' a serem aplicados. Exemplo:
#Include "PROTHEUS.CH" User Function PLROBPRC() cQuery := ParamIxb[1] cWhere := ParamIxb[2]
cWhere += " AND BXX_CODRDA igual '000130' " // informado a palavra igual apenas para publicacao do documento, deve ser utilizado '='.
Return cQuery + cWhere